Question 492: To ask the Minister for Education and Science the recognition status of a school (details supplied) in County Clare; if he will recognise that this is the only multi-denominational school in north Clare and thus is essential for catering to those of minority faiths and none in the area; if his Department recently conducted an inspection of the school; the conclusions reached by the inspector;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[24582/09]
Batt O'Keeffe (Cork North West,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context
The inspection of the school referred to by the Deputy is not yet completed. My Department will be extending the provisional recognition of the school for a further school year and a detailed letter has issued to the school authorities in this regard.
